Output 2b865e2e7ee745d3cd2c1b653abfc24e2bf3bdca6afb6e013bed2a26ea39d89a:4

value
37588743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b88336ed3d5e74d8958f67ecd626b34a9b09261 OP_EQUAL
address
3JnbSpaeNt1vFQygRB2gEfATVjyuR6V51n
transaction
2b865e2e7ee745d3cd2c1b653abfc24e2bf3bdca6afb6e013bed2a26ea39d89a
confirmations
398890
spent
true